Bhubaneswar: The National Centre for Disease Control (NCDC) right this moment revealed that as many as three UK strains of COVID-19, have been detected in Odisha. However, Odisha Health Minister has assured to not panic. He urged the individuals to not panic because the state authorities has taken mandatory steps to include the unfold of the UK mutant pressure.
“We knew about the detection of the three UK strains in the state after the Indian Council of Medical Research (ICMR) had revealed this during the genome sequencing in December last year. But we had kept it under wraps apprehending that people will panic,” Additional Chief Secretary, Health, Pradipta Mohapatra instructed mediapersons right here.
